Re: SUO: The Story So Far - Request for vote




>Nicola's proposal, below, makes a lot of sense to me.
>
>    In practice, my proposal is as follows:
>
>    1. Let's carefully (and painfully) distinguish between axioms and
>    primitives that achieve (reasonably large) consensus and
>    axioms/primitives that do not;
>
>    2. When there is no consensus, let's isolate the alternatives and ask
>    the supporters to i) explain, ii) motivate and iii) formalize both of
>    them;
>
>    3. If enough explanation/motivation/formalization is achieved (up to
>    a certain minimal degree) for both alternatives, then:
>	3.1 create a new branch in the ontology library
>	3.2 go on specializing the two branches in parallel, depending on
>    the interest they
>	    receive.
>
>    4. Else proceed by considering only the alternative that was best
>    explained, motivated, and formalized.
>    ----

To me too. In fact I think something like this is the only rational 
way to proceed.
